What is the typical home price in Crane, MO?
In Crane, MO the median home value sits at $245K. Against the broader MO market, that reads as reasonable for most investors.
Is Crane, MO a friendly market for rental owners?
Crane, MO falls under MO landlord-tenant law, which is landlord-friendly. That backdrop makes day-to-day property management reasonable.
